21xrx.com
2024-12-22 20:01:50 Sunday
登录
文章检索 我的文章 写文章
MySQL如何高效更新大数据量
2023-06-09 20:52:30 深夜i     --     --
MySQL 大数据更新 高效

MySQL是流行的开源关系型数据库,用于处理各种中小规模数据存储任务。MySQL可以快速处理大量数据,但在处理大数据更新时会出现性能问题。

怎样才能高效地更新大数据量?以下是一些有用的技巧和最佳实践:

1. 批量更新

批量更新可以极大地提高MySQ的更新性能。在MySQL中,一个SQL语句只能更新一条记录。如果需要更新大量数据,则可将多个更新语句合并为一个批量更新语句。

2. 增加索引

索引的作用是在表中查找数据时快速定位记录。如果表中有索引,MySQL可以更快速地定位需要更新的记录。应该在更新之前,为相关字段增加索引。在更新完成后,可以将所添加的索引删除。

3. 分区表

将数据库表分成较小的分区表,可以大大提高更新性能。MySQL专门针对大量数据处理提供了一个分区功能。分区表可将一张表分成多个表,每个表仅包含一部分数据。MySQL可以对每个分区表进行单独的更新操作,而不会影响其他分区表。

在MySQL中高效更新大数据量并不是一件容易的事情,但通过批量更新、增加索引和分区表这些方法,可以大大提高MySQL的更新性能。

  
  

评论区

{{item['qq_nickname']}}
()
回复
回复